Re: Return to Ruins SP Campaign
I know the reason. You forgot to capitalize the word peasant.
You had:
It should be:
I tested it, it works.
You had:
Code: Select all
recruit= Footpad,Bowman,Spearman,peasant
Code: Select all
recruit= Footpad,Bowman,Spearman,Peasant

Re: Return to Ruins SP Campaign
Harold is a level 1 unit andSneezy wrote:Harold starts out with max XP= 1; and after he destroys an enemy unit, he's at XP= 8/1; but he doesn't advance(!). That seems wrong. Is it intended?
advances_to=null
, that means he doesn't level up to a level 2 unit, but he shouldn't start with experience=0
.@Ulfsark: Set Harolds experience to something between 30 and 60, so he can use AMLA
That is because of a wrong setting in Nylands unit_type.cfgSneezy wrote:Also, Nyland started out as a lev-1 lawful unit. In scenario 3, he advanced to trapper, and became a chaotic unit. Was that intended?
Current setting:
advances_to=Trapper
Right setting:
advances_to=Nyland_Upgrade
And for level three uses Nyland the mainline units Huntsman or Ranger, and those units are chaotic.
@Ulfsark: Why don't you give Nyland a own level 3 unit_type.cfg?
You can use [base_unit]
